About the scholarship
The Tim Cooper Memorial Scholarship was established in 2024 and is funded by the Guardians of New Zealand Superannuation in memory of a valued colleague, Tim Cooper. The main purpose of the Scholarship is to support and encourage students to study and pursue careers in software and computer systems engineering, particularly in the New Zealand finance and investment sectors.
Entry requirements
Must be a New Zealand Citizen or Permanent Resident enrolled in Part III of a BE(Hons) in Computer Systems Engineering or Software Engineering.
